David J. Autrey, age 83, of the South Toe Community, went Home to be with the Lord, surrounded by his loving family, at Mission Hospital on Sunday, April 6th, 2025. He was a son of the late Jasper and Bonnie Gouge Autrey. David was also preceded in death by his brothers: Leland Autrey, Ranis Autrey, Randy Autrey and Lewis Autrey; and two sisters: Augusta Branch and Sadie Autrey.
David was a district manager for the Asheville Citizen-Times. In later years, he was a successful business owner and was a licensed landscaping contractor. He proudly served his country in the U.S. Army, stationed in Germany. He was a member of South Estatoe Baptist Church. He enjoyed coon hunting and fishing, but most of all spending time with his family and friends, as well as traveling.
Surviving are his loving wife of 62 years, Martha Dale Autrey; sons: David Autrey (Sherri) of Burnsville, NC, Chris Autrey (Kristie) of Green Mountain, NC, Jeff Autrey (Linda) of Unicoi, TN, Steve Autrey (Marcy) of Mooresville, NC, and Charlie Autrey (Becky) of Burnsville, NC; twelve grandchildren; fourteen great- grandchildren; sister-in-law, Margaret Autrey; brother-in-law, Dean Branch: and close friend, Mitchell (Mickey) Westall. Several nieces and nephews also survive.
Funeral services will be held at 5:30 p.m. on Saturday, April 12th at South Estatoe Baptist Church. Pastor Greg Alderman and Pastor Jeff Reecer will officiate. Graveside services will follow in the South Estatoe Baptist Church Cemetery. Pallbearers will be Ethan Stafford, Aaron Autrey, Andrew Autrey, Patrick Stafford, Jake Autrey and Jeremy Hoilman. The family will receive friends from 3:30 until 5:30 p.m. prior to the funeral services at the church.
In lieu of flowers donations may be made to South Estatoe Baptist Church Missions Fund, 32 South Estatoe Baptist Church Road, Burnsville, NC 28714.
